Rig Operations

The month of August has seen steady progress on the Yukon Flats Exploration Project. Hilcorp’s custom-built drilling rig—which has been specially designed to operate in the Yukon Flats region with a minimal footprint—is in place and operational after being transferred by barge and helicopter. Activity is underway at the project site near Birch Creek. 

Air traffic is expected to occur at a regular pace during this phase of the project. In August and September, chartered flights will continue to transport supplies from Fairbanks to Birch Creek, and Hilcorp’s Chinook helicopter will be moderately active in the Birch Creek area. At the same time, Yukon Flats barge operations will slow to approximately one trip per week, traveling between the Yukon River bridge and the Lower Birch Creek Slough.  

Looking Ahead 

Operations at the project site will continue for the duration of the 2025 summer exploration season, until mid-October. Exploration of both identified drill sites is expected to continue into 2026. Doyon will continue to provide updates and transparently share progress with all shareholders.
